Utah Jazz at Memphis Grizzlies (+6.5, 202)

What the hell has gotten into the Utah Jazz? The club went from the 25th best offense in the league in December to the second best offense over the last 10 games. The Jazz are 8-2 straight up and against the spread over the last 10 games and are averaging 115.6 points over the same stretch.

And they’re doing this all with their two top scorers, Donovan Mitchell and Rodney Hood, in and out of the lineup with various injuries. On top of that key contributors like Hood and Derrick Favors know their names are out in the trade market and veteran reserve Joe Johnson reportedly has told management he wants out.

Ricky Rubio seems to be the glue keeping things humming in Utah. The veteran point guard is averaging 21 points and 9.2 assists while hitting 62.5 percent of his attempts from 3-point land over the last five games.

Pick: Over 202

Minnesota Timberwolves at Cleveland Cavaliers (+4, 221)

The Cavs are coming off an 18-point home loss to the worst team in the Eastern Conference that was missing its best player. How bad are things for the Cavs right now?

The Timberwolves don’t always know what they’re going to get night-to-night from Andrew Wiggins, but that’s not the case against Cleveland. Wiggins makes a habit of producing some of his best games against the team that traded him away before playing his first game as a pro. He averages 29.1 points on 54.7 shooting percentage in seven career games against the Cavs.

Pick: Timberwolves -4

Injury of Note

Phoenix Suns will not have their leading scoring in uniform for tonight’s game against the San Antonio Spurs. Devin Booker has missed two of the Suns’ last five games because of a banged up hip and bruised ribs. He’s averaging 24.1 points, 4.4 rebounds and 4.9 assists per game and the Suns are 5-6-1 ATS in the 12 games he’s missed this season.

Victor Oladipo is questionable to play tonight for the Indiana Pacers because of the same illness that kept him out Tuesday against the Wizards. Oladipo is having a career season and made his first All-Star team this year. The Pacers are 0-6 ATS without him in the lineup this season.
